about

Daniel & Lizzi are an unlikely pair. A singer-songwriter with a background in punk rock and a classically trained cellist, these two met one serendipitous summer and created a sound that defied their personal conventions. With Ron McGill on drums, Foxxhound plays upon their differences by highlighting their unique styles in songs that range from folk-pop tunes to bluesy ballads. ... more
